Microsoft SQL Server C'est un système de gestion de base de données relationnelle développé par Microsoft. Ce logiciel est utilisé par des organisations de toutes tailles pour gérer et analyser les données de manière efficace. L'objectif de cet article est d'expliquer en détail, mais de manière compréhensible, ce qu'est Microsoft SQL Server et comment il est utilisé.
À quoi sert SQL Server?
Microsoft SQL Server est une plateforme complète pour la gestion des données, utilisée pour une variété de fins :
- Archivage des données : Permet de stocker de grandes quantités de données de manière sûre et organisée.
- Gestion des données Facilite la gestion des données, y compris la création, la lecture, la mise à jour et la suppression (CRUD) de ces données.
- Analyse des données Offre des outils pour analyser les données et générer des rapports détaillés.
- Sécurité Fournit des fonctionnalités de sécurité robustes pour protéger les données sensibles.
- Intégration Il s'intègre avec d'autres logiciels et services pour améliorer la fonctionnalité globale.
SQL Server est essentiel pour les entreprises qui ont besoin de gérer de grands volumes de données de manière efficace et sécurisée.
Quelle est la différence entre SQL et MySQL?
SQL (Structured Query Language) est un langage standard utilisé pour gérer et manipuler les bases de données. SQL Server et MySQL sont tous deux des systèmes de gestion de bases de données qui utilisent SQL, mais présentent quelques différences clés :
- Serveur SQL : Développé par Microsoft, il s'agit d'un logiciel commercial avec des licences propriétaires.
- MySQL : Développé par Oracle Corporation, c'est un logiciel open source.
- Serveur SQL : Optimisé pour l'écosystème Microsoft, s'intégrant facilement avec d'autres produits Microsoft tels que Azure et Visual Studio.
- MySQL : Il peut être exécuté sur différentes plateformes, y compris Linux, macOS et Windows.
- Serveur SQL Offre des fonctionnalités avancées de business intelligence, de reporting et d'analyse de données.
- MySQL Connu pour sa simplicité et sa rapidité, souvent utilisé pour des applications web.
- Serveur SQL : Cela peut s'avérer coûteux en raison des licences propriétaires.
- MySQL Étant open source, il peut être utilisé gratuitement, bien qu'il existe des versions commerciales avec des fonctionnalités supplémentaires.
Comment fait-on une requête SQL?
Les requêtes SQL sont des commandes utilisées pour interagir avec la base de données. Voici un exemple de comment exécuter les opérations de base :
Création d'une table :
CREATE TABLE Clients (
ID INT CLÉ PRIMAIRE,
Nom VARCHAR(50),
Nom de famille VARCHAR(50),
Email VARCHAR(100)
);
Insertion de données :
INSERT INTO Clients (ID, Nom, Prénom, Email)
VALUES (1, 'Mario', 'Rossi', 'mario.rossi@example.com');
Lecture des données :
SELECT * FROM Clients;
Mise à jour des données :
MISE À JOUR Clients
SET Email = 'mario.rossi@newdomain.com'
OÙ ID = 1;
Suppression des données :
DELETE FROM Clients
WHERE ID = 1;
Ces opérations fondamentales constituent la base de la gestion des données dans une base de données relationnelle.
Qui utilise généralement SQL?
SQL Server est utilisé par une vaste gamme d'utilisateurs et d'organisations:
- Grandes entreprises : Pour la gestion d'énormes quantités de données d'entreprise.
- PME (Petites et Moyennes Entreprises) : Pour gérer les données des clients, des ventes et des opérations internes.
- Organismes gouvernementaux : Pour conserver des registres et des données sensibles.
- Instituts de recherche : Pour analyser des données complexes.
- Développeurs de logiciels : Pour créer des applications nécessitant une base de données backend robuste.
- Analystes de données : Pour extraire des informations significatives des données collectées.
Description technique des variantes
Microsoft SQL Server est disponible en plusieurs éditions, chacune conçue pour répondre à des besoins spécifiques :
- Version gratuite, idéale pour des applications de petite taille.
- Limitations sur les dimensions de la base de données et les fonctionnalités.
- Adapté pour les PME.
- Offre un bon équilibre entre coûts et fonctionnalités.
- Conçu pour les grandes entreprises avec des besoins complexes.
- Il comprend toutes les fonctionnalités avancées, telles que la haute disponibilité et la sécurité avancée.
- Version gratuite pour le développement et le test.
- Comprend toutes les fonctionnalités de l'édition Enterprise, mais ne peut pas être utilisée en production.
- Optimisé pour l'hébergement web.
- Licences à bas coût pour les fournisseurs de services web.
Différence entre SQL Server en local ou dans le cloud
SQL Server peut être déployé à la fois localement et dans le cloud, et chaque approche a ses avantages :
En Local
- Contrôle complet Les administrateurs ont un contrôle total sur le matériel et le logiciel.
- Personnalisation Il est possible de configurer l'environnement en fonction des besoins spécifiques.
- Sécurité Contrôle accru de la sécurité physique et logique des données.
Dans le Cloud
- Scalabilité Il est facile d'adapter les ressources en fonction de la demande.
- Coûts réduits Il n'est pas nécessaire d'investir dans du matériel coûteux.
- Accessibilité : Les données sont accessibles partout, à tout moment.
- Mises à jour automatiques : Les mises à jour logicielles sont gérées par le fournisseur du cloud.
Considérations
- Performances : Les performances peuvent varier en fonction de l'infrastructure et de la connectivité.
- Coûts Évaluer le coût à long terme du cloud par rapport à l'investissement initial pour les solutions locales.
- Sécurité Considérer les politiques de sécurité du fournisseur de cloud.
Combien ça coûte?
Le coût de SQL Server varie en fonction de l'édition et des besoins spécifiques. Voici un aperçu général :
- SQL Server Standard : Licence basée sur le noyau, avec un prix de 399 € pour 1 appareil.
- SQL Server Enterprise Plus cher, avec des licences à partir de 499 € pour 1 appareil.
- Développeur de SQL Server : Gratuit pour le développement et le test.
- Serveur Web SQL Licences à bas coût, généralement négociées par des accords avec les fournisseurs d'hébergement.
Conclusions
Microsoft SQL Server est une solution puissante et polyvalente pour la gestion des données, adaptée à une large gamme d'applications. Ses différentes éditions et options de distribution offrent flexibilité et scalabilité pour répondre aux besoins de toute organisation, grande ou petite. Lors du choix de SQL Server, il est important de prendre en compte les besoins spécifiques de l'entreprise, les coûts et les options de distribution pour obtenir la valeur maximale de l'investissement.
Laisse un commentaire